Ingredients (Serves 4)
Chicken & Rub
-
1 lb chicken breasts, pounded to even thickness
-
2 tbsp olive oil
-
2 tbsp lime juice (about 1 lime)
-
Zest of 1 lime
-
1 tsp chili powder
-
1 tsp brown sugar
-
¾ tsp salt
-
½ tsp ground cumin
-
½ tsp smoked paprika
-
½ tsp onion powder
-
½ tsp garlic powder
-
¼–½ tsp chipotle chili powder (optional, for heat)
-
¼ tsp black pepper
Avocado Salsa
-
2 medium avocados, diced
-
1 cup cherry tomatoes, quartered (or 2 Roma tomatoes)
-
Corn from 1 ear (fresh or grilled)
-
⅓ cup finely chopped red onion
-
½ red bell pepper, chopped
-
1 jalapeño, minced (seeds optional)
-
2 tbsp cilantro, chopped
-
1 garlic clove, minced
-
2 tbsp lime juice
-
¼ tsp cumin
-
Salt & pepper to taste
Step-by-Step Instructions
Step 1: Season the Chicken
In a small bowl, mix together all the rub ingredients. This spice blend is what gives Fiesta Lime Chicken with Fresh Avocado Salsa its signature flavor.
Coat the chicken evenly on all sides. Let it marinate for at least 30 minutes, though longer marination (up to 8 hours) allows the lime and spices to deeply penetrate the meat.
Marinating not only enhances flavor but also ensures the chicken stays juicy and tender.
Step 2: Cook the Chicken
Stovetop Method
Heat a lightly greased skillet over medium-high heat. Place the chicken in the pan and cook for 3–5 minutes until browned.
Flip, cover, reduce heat, and cook for another 5–7 minutes until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C).
Let the chicken rest for 5 minutes before slicing to retain juices.
Grill Method
Preheat grill to medium heat (375–450°F / 190–230°C).
Grill chicken 5–7 minutes per side. Rest before slicing.
Grilling gives Fiesta Lime Chicken with Fresh Avocado Salsa a subtle smoky char that elevates the flavor even more.
Step 3: Make the Salsa
Combine everything except the avocados. Chill for 30 minutes if possible to allow flavors to meld.
Gently fold in the diced avocados right before serving to keep them fresh and vibrant.
Step 4: Serve
Slice the chicken and top generously with fresh avocado salsa. Add extra lime juice if desired.

Meal Prep & Storage
This recipe is excellent for weekly meal prep. Cook extra chicken and salsa, then portion into containers.
Store chicken separately from salsa to maintain freshness. The chicken keeps for 4 days refrigerated. Salsa stays fresh about 2 days.
Reheat chicken gently and top with freshly mixed avocado salsa.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use chicken thighs?
Yes, thighs are juicier and work beautifully.
Can I bake instead of grill?
Absolutely. Bake at 400°F for 20–25 minutes.
How do I keep avocado from browning?
Add extra lime juice and store airtight.
Is it spicy?
Only mildly. Adjust chipotle or jalapeño to taste.
